Step-by-step explanation

We are given the domain of x for the expression, y = - |x|

We are then asked to calculate the range of values for y

when x = -1

y = - |x| = - |-1| = - (1) = -1

when x = 0

y = - |x| = - |0| = - (0) = 0

when x = 1

y = - |x| = - |1| = - (1) = -1

when x = 2

y = - |x| = - |-2| = - (2) = -2
